Dear all, it seems that with FreeBSD 15 there is additional permission required to execute pfctl. With FreeBSD 14 I had in /etc/devfs.conf: own pf root:icinga perm pf 0640 this allowed the group icinga to use pfctl, but now I get: pfctl: Failed to open netlink: Bad file descriptor does anyone have a idea what additional change in FreeBSD 15 is required to allow a normal user to use pfctl to read information about the pf firewall?
